You have gotten some great suggestions here. My dad is from London too but he’s been here for close to 70 years now.

There isn’t a British Community here that I’m aware of, but you should feel pretty at home at the Waltzing Weasel, Church Key or the King Edward.

They are all similar to pubs I frequented when I visited my relatives a few times.

The British store that was mentioned will have many of the snacks that are being missed as well.

Also, Walmart in Hyde Park has an international section that has some of my British faves.
